The going is Good.
Finished behind Wee Mary when fifth of ten at Carlisle last week; best on good or slower ground so wouldn't be ideally suited by drying conditions.
Two wins for Iain Jardine this year, the latest at Hamilton last month off a 3lb lower mark; good second over C&D 16 days ago; more appealing than most.
Slipped to a good mark and there was much more encouragement from him at Ripon nine days ago, making the running and beaten just over 2l at the finish; one to consider, especially if backed.
Two of his three wins have come over C&D, the latest last August off a 4lb higher mark; not found his best in two runs this year but he's the type to pop up at some point.
18-race maiden; dropping down the weights but his two runs this year have seen him finish last at Ayr and over C&D; hood replaces a visor today; likely to pop up at some point but stable have more obvious claims with Wee Mary.
